A Contract for Deed is used as owner financing for the purchase of real property. The Seller retains title to the property until an agreed amount is paid. After the agreed amount is paid, the Seller conveys the property to Buyer.

Mn deeds without refers to a legal instrument used in property transactions where the property owner transfers the ownership of real estate without utilizing a traditional warranty deed. This type of transfer often occurs when the seller is unable or unwilling to provide a warranty of title to the buyer. In Mn deed without transactions, the seller does not make any guarantees about the condition of the property or any potential legal issues related to the title. It is important for potential buyers to thoroughly research the property and address any concerns before proceeding with the purchase. While there may not be specific types of Mn deed without, variations of this type of transfer include: 1. Quitclaim Deed: This is the most common type of Mn deed without, where the seller relinquishes any interest or claim they may have in the property. These deeds do not provide any guarantees regarding the title, but simply transfer whatever ownership interest the seller may possess. 2. Special Warranty Deed: In some cases, sellers may prefer to provide a limited warranty of title instead of a full warranty. A special warranty deed guarantees that the seller has not caused any encumbrances or defects in title during their ownership, but does not cover any issues that may have existed prior to their ownership. 3. Executor's Deed: When a property is sold as part of an estate settlement, an executor's deed may be used. This type of deed is issued by the executor of a deceased person's estate to transfer ownership to the buyer. It typically includes similar provisions as a quitclaim deed, without any warranties. It is important for both buyers and sellers to consult with a qualified real estate attorney or professional to fully understand the implications of engaging in a Mn deed without transaction. Conducting a thorough title search and obtaining title insurance can provide some protection against potential risks associated with this type of transfer.
